EDITORS COMMENTS
This striking poster announces the performance of "The 9 O'Clock Revue" at the Little Theatre located on John Street in the Adelphi area of London, circa 1922. The design features an elegant woman in a flowing red dress, gazing up at a large ornate clock with the hands pointing to nine o'clock. Surrounding the central image are the words "The 9 O'Clock Revue" in bold black letters, with "Entertainment" and "Production" in smaller white text below. The poster's color palette of black, red, and white creates a bold and dynamic visual effect, drawing the viewer's attention to the upcoming performance. The 1920s, also known as the Roaring Twenties or the Jazz Age, was a time of cultural and social change, marked by new forms of entertainment and artistic expression. The revue, a popular theatrical form of the era, was characterized by its variety of acts, including music, dance, comedy, and drama. The 9 O'Clock Revue, with its intriguing title and eye-catching poster, would have promised an exciting and entertaining evening out for London audiences. The Little Theatre, located in the heart of the city, was a hub of artistic activity during this period, attracting both local and international performers. With its focus on innovative and provocative productions, the theatre was an important part of the cultural landscape of 1920s London. This poster serves as a fascinating glimpse into the past, offering a glimpse into the world of live entertainment during a time of great social and artistic change.
